How they compare
Pakistan currently reports -8.7% against -9.5% in Armenia, a difference of 0.8%.
The two have swapped places 18 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Pakistan ahead.
Armenia ranks 176th and Pakistan ranks 174th of 181 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Armenia averaged higher in 1 and Pakistan in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Armenia | Pakistan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 7.0% | 7.8% | 0.8% | Pakistan |
| 2010s | 2.5% | 2.8% | 0.2% | Pakistan |
| 2020s | 0.3% | -0.7% | 1.0% | Armenia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
